First just a note that I was running v0.1.0b6 as a service and my GW1000
lost it's WIFI connection. Actual dropped WIFI connecting by the GW1000.
Looking at the log I see that  the driver worked perfectly, it logged a
connection failure after 3 attempts, but weewx itself kept running so that
only the supplemental data from the GW1000 was lost. Once I relocated the
GW1000 to a better location , without restarting WeeWX, the GW1000 data
started flowing again. Perfect just the behavior I would want.

Just updated to v0.1.0b7 here is what is returned for battery status:
wh31_ch2_batt: 0, wh31_ch4_batt: 0, wh31_ch5_batt: 0, wh31_ch7_batt: 0,
wh57_batt: 5
So all sensors recognized, not sure of the meaning of "0" and "5" and why
wh57 returns "5" All sensors installed with new batteries 3 days ago .

> I have released v0.1.0b7 on Github
> <https://github.com/gjr80/weewx-gw1000/releases>. b7 adds the battery
> states to the default field map which should see battery states appear in
> the loop packets. I expect there will still be some naming issues,
> especially with WH65 and WH32. b7 also fixes a n issue where wind direction
> was wrongly decoded..
>
> Those that have already installed the driver can download and install
> v0.1.0b7 using the following commands depending on your WeeWX install type:
>
> for setup.py installs:
>
> $ sudo mv /home/weewx/bin/user/gw1000.py /home/weewx/bin/user/gw1000_orig.
> py
> $ sudo wget -P /home/weewx/bin/user https://
> raw.githubusercontent.com/gjr80/weewx-gw1000/v0.1.0b7/bin/user/gw1000.py
> <http://raw.githubusercontent.com/gjr80/weewx-gw1000/v0.1.0b6/bin/user/gw1000.py>
>
> for package installs:
>
> $ sudo mv /usr/share/weewx/user/gw1000.py /usr/share/weewx/user/
> gw1000_orig.py
> $ sudo wget -P /usr/share/weewx/user https://
> raw.githubusercontent.com/gjr80/weewx-gw1000/v0.1.0b7/bin/user/gw1000.py
> <http://raw.githubusercontent.com/gjr80/weewx-gw1000/v0.1.0b6/bin/user/gw1000.py>
>
> There has been no change to the [GW1000] structure so you can just
> restart WeeWX/run v0.1.0b7 directly without further changes.
